Product Catalogs with Detailed Specifications

Comprehensive product catalogs represent the core content asset for energy equipment websites. Each product page should include complete technical specifications presented in both user-friendly summaries and detailed tabular formats. Standard elements include performance metrics under various operating conditions, dimensional data, compatibility information, and compliance certifications. For complex equipment, interactive configuration tools that allow users to model different operating scenarios significantly enhance engagement and lead qualification.

Technical specification presentation requires careful balance between completeness and accessibility. Consider implementing expandable sections that allow technical users to access comprehensive data while maintaining clean page layouts for casual browsers. Comparison tables enabling side-by-side evaluation of different models help customers make informed decisions. All specification data should be downloadable in multiple formats (PDF, Excel) for integration into customer procurement and design processes. High-quality product imagery, including 360-degree views and cutaway diagrams, provides visual context for technical information.

Request a Quote/Contact Forms

Strategic contact form design directly impacts lead generation effectiveness for energy equipment businesses. Instead of generic contact forms, implement purpose-built quote request forms that capture essential qualification information. Standard fields should include project type, application context, timeline, budget range, and specific product interests. Progressive profiling that gradually collects more detailed information across multiple interactions improves conversion rates while respecting user patience.

Form placement and triggering significantly influence conversion rates. Contextual forms embedded within product pages convert 35% better than standalone contact pages according to Hong Kong digital marketing benchmarks. Exit-intent popups offering specialized content (such as customized ROI calculations) recover approximately 15% of abandoning visitors. Integration with CRM systems ensures immediate lead routing to appropriate sales engineers based on product interest and project complexity. Automated confirmation emails should provide useful next steps rather than generic acknowledgments.

Downloads (Brochures, Manuals, Technical Data Sheets)

Technical documentation represents a critical component of energy equipment website construction. Organized resource libraries containing product brochures, installation manuals, maintenance guides, and technical data sheets serve both pre-purchase evaluation and post-purchase reference needs. Implement a structured categorization system allowing filtering by document type, product category, and application context. Each download should include clear version information and publication dates to ensure users access current documentation.

Gated content strategy balances accessibility with lead generation. While basic specification sheets should remain freely accessible, consider requiring minimal contact information for comprehensive technical manuals or specialized application guides. This approach provides value to users while generating qualified leads. The registration process should be streamlined, typically requesting only name, company, and email address. Automated follow-up sequences can then deliver additional relevant content based on downloaded materials, gradually nurturing prospects toward sales conversations.

Optimizing Content for SEO

Strategic website SEO implementation ensures your energy equipment content reaches interested prospects through organic search. Comprehensive keyword research identifies both commercial intent terms ("industrial chiller price") and informational queries ("how to improve chiller efficiency"). On-page optimization includes strategic keyword placement in titles, headings, and body content while maintaining natural readability. Technical SEO elements like schema markup for products and local business information enhance search result visibility.

Content optimization for Energy Equipment SEO requires understanding searcher intent across the purchase journey. Early-stage researchers seek educational content addressing problems and solutions, while late-stage searchers look for specific product comparisons and purchasing information. Creating content clusters around core topic areas establishes topical authority, which search engines increasingly reward. Local SEO optimization is particularly important for Hong Kong-based companies, with complete Google Business Profile optimization, local citation consistency, and location-specific content addressing Hong Kong regulatory requirements and application contexts.

Performance Monitoring and Optimization

Continuous performance monitoring ensures your energy equipment website maintains optimal user experience and search visibility. Core web vitals including loading speed, interactivity, and visual stability directly impact both user satisfaction and search rankings according to Google's algorithm updates. Regular performance audits identify optimization opportunities such as image compression, code minification, and caching implementation. Hong Kong users particularly value fast-loading websites, with bounce rates increasing dramatically after three-second load times.

Performance optimization requires balancing multiple factors. While rich media enhances engagement, it must be implemented without compromising loading speed. Lazy loading for images and videos, conditional loading for non-essential elements, and content delivery network implementation for global audiences all contribute to maintained performance. Mobile performance deserves particular attention given increasing mobile usage for B2B research. Continuous performance monitoring rather than periodic checking identifies regression issues before they significantly impact user experience or conversions.
